The Essential Importance Of The Emergency Pull Cord In Disabled Toilets
Disabled toilets are an essential amenity that should be readily available in public spaces to ensure equal access and convenience for individuals with disabilities These facilities are equipped with a range of features to accommodate the needs of disabled individuals, including wider doorways, grab bars, and raised toilet seats One critical feature of disabled toilets is the emergency pull cord, which plays a vital role in ensuring the safety and well-being of users In this article, we will explore the significance of the emergency pull cord in disabled toilets and why it is essential to ensure that this device is always functioning properly.
The emergency pull cord in a disabled toilet is a safety mechanism that allows users to call for help in the event of an emergency This cord is typically located within reach of the toilet and is designed to be easy to locate and use by individuals with disabilities When pulled, the cord sends a signal to a monitoring system or staff on site, alerting them that assistance is needed This feature is crucial for individuals who may require assistance with using the toilet or who may experience a medical emergency while in the bathroom.
One of the primary reasons why the emergency pull cord is so essential in disabled toilets is that it provides a sense of security and reassurance to users For individuals with disabilities, using a public restroom can be a daunting experience, as they may be concerned about their safety and ability to access assistance if needed The presence of the emergency pull cord helps to alleviate these fears, as users know that help is always just a pull away This peace of mind is invaluable for individuals with disabilities and can make a significant difference in their overall comfort and confidence when using public restroom facilities.

Whether a user experiences a medical emergency, a fall, or another type of crisis while in the bathroom, the ability to quickly summon help can be a lifesaving measure By pulling the emergency cord, users can alert staff or emergency responders to their situation and receive the assistance they need in a timely manner This can prevent serious injuries or complications and ensure that individuals with disabilities are able to access the care they require.
Inadequate maintenance or disabled emergency pull cords that are not functioning properly can pose a serious risk to the safety and well-being of disabled individuals If the emergency pull cord is disabled or not functioning correctly, users may be unable to summon help in an emergency, leaving them vulnerable and at risk of harm This is why it is essential for facility managers and maintenance staff to regularly inspect and test the emergency pull cords in disabled toilets to ensure that they are in good working order Regular maintenance and prompt repairs are essential to prevent accidents and ensure that disabled individuals can use these facilities safely and confidently.
